Definitions from Wiktionary (get one's eye in)
▸ verb: (chiefly UK, sports) To become accustomed to the playing conditions, and thus bring one's hand-eye coordination to a reasonable level.
▸ verb: (chiefly UK) To develop a perceptual skill, especially visual.
